👨‍🍳 Instructions

Beat egg, water, shortening and lemon juice until frothy.

Mix in dry ingredients until well blended.

Dip onion rings; let excess batter drip off.

Fry in small amounts in about 1-inch of oil which has been heated to 375°.

Fry about 3 to 4 minutes or until golden brown.

Drain on paper towels.

Spread out in a single layer on cookie sheet.

Place in 325° oven to keep hot until remainder are cooked.
